Re mask bans: sunglasses conceal people's identity more effectively than masks do, but everyone would object to a sunglasses ban.

The difference is that sunglasses are completely normalized accessibility devices, while masks have been pathologized as part of the total erasure of the pandemic.
cleanairclub.bsky.social
Re. the Columbia mask ban: imagine how absurd it would be for them to ban sunglasses worn "to conceal identity" but not "for medical reasons."

How could that even be enforceable? Who determines intent? What would count as a medical reason?

It's so important to prioritize schools that have poor air quality due to environmental racism!

The closer schools are to highways, which historically run through neighborhoods of color, the worse the air. Air purifiers are a racial equity issue.
smarterhepa.bsky.social
🚌 The schools that we prioritize getting air purifiers to are ones that are disproportionately impacted by pollution, usually due to proximity to highways or air-polluting industry. But we believe that every kid deserves clean air at school, no matter where they live!

For those who find cutting the mask hole difficult, we recommend using either an X-acto knife or a 0.625" craft hole punch.

Sip valve recommends using scissors and it's really hard to get a precise circle cut with them.
cleanairclub.bsky.social
With this source, you can buy one official Sip Valve (for the ring that creates the seal) and then identical but cheaper replacement valves. It lowers the per-use cost dramatically
